Location

Life in Hoveton and Wroxham is an idyllic blend of rural charm and waterside living. Known as the "Capital of the Broads, " this picturesque region offers a unique lifestyle centred around the waterways. Residents and visitors alike enjoy leisurely cruises, watersports, and fishing on the River Bure and the surrounding Broads. Many homes, particularly those on prestigious roads like "The Avenues, " boast stunning river views or even private moorings.

There's far more than just the waterways, though. The locally famous "Roys" brand provides the villages with many different shops for food, clothing, and general needs. There's even a petrol station. Alongside the amenities that Roys delivers, there is also schooling for all ages, a good medical centre, cafes, restaurants, fast food, fishing opportunities, and nature walks.
